Output 8e64a153bd853d1d5106ded94c08b69c8c1a0a409d7996dc67c26ba5a72efce6:0

value
579507
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cdc4e63dd3af4af9505836591ffce79be91d9fd5 OP_EQUAL
address
3LT2KgGRdmWiJ2327QkFp1FJajqFeKXuWd
transaction
8e64a153bd853d1d5106ded94c08b69c8c1a0a409d7996dc67c26ba5a72efce6